Comparing New Hampshire, United States with Doral, Florida

Compare Climate information for New Hampshire, United States and Doral, Florida

Is New Hampshire, United States warmer or hotter than Doral, Florida?

On average across the year, no, New Hampshire, United States is not hotter than Doral, Florida . New Hampshire, United States has an average temperature of 9°C/48°F and Doral, Florida has an average temperature of 26°C/79°F.

New Hampshire, United States's hottest month is July, with an average maximum temperature of 29°C/84°F, which is not hotter than Doral, Florida's hottest month (August, with an average maximum temperature of 33°C/91°F).

Is New Hampshire, United States colder or cooler than Doral, Florida?

On average across the year, yes, New Hampshire, United States is colder than Doral, Florida . New Hampshire, United States has an average minimum temperature of 3°C/37°F and Doral, Florida has an average minimum temperature of 22°C/72°F.



New Hampshire, United States's coldest month is January, with an average minimum temperature of -9°C/16°F, which is colder than Doral, Florida's coldest month (also January, with an average minimum temperature of 17°C/63°F).

Does New Hampshire, United States have more rain than Doral, Florida?

On average across the year, no, New Hampshire, United States has less rain than Doral, Florida. New Hampshire, United States has an average annual rainfall of 1196mm and Doral, Florida has an average annual rainfall of 1963mm.

New Hampshire, United States's wettest month is October, with an average monthly rainfall of 130mm, which is drier than Doral, Florida's wettest month (June, with an average monthly rainfall of 302mm).
